The district is putting the brakes on an earlier plan to have delayed openings at every Ridgewood school once a month for teacher collaboration time.

The implementation of “Collaboration Days” for teachers in grades K-8 will not start until the 2014-15 school year, said Superintendent Daniel Fishbein in a letter sent to parents this week.
The decision to postpone the district-wide installment of Collaboration Days – which have taken place at Ridgewood High School (RHS) since the end of the 2011-2012 school year and will continue this year – was made to give parents more time to prepare for the change, the superintendent said.
Fishbein noted that he intended to get parents the information before they found out through other means.
